Two held after bomb attacks

A father and son with links to the extreme right have been arrested in connection with a series of letter-bomb attacks in Austria, AFP reports from Vienna .

The two men were identified only as a 66-year-old former chemist, Franz R, and his 26-year-old son, who has the same name. The son served a jail sentence last year for trying to restore Nazi rule in Austria. The Interior Minister, Franz Loeschnak, said that the two men were extremists and had links with VAPO, an ultra-radical militant movement.
